Hospital: Leicester Royal Infirmary
Deanery: England
LETB: East Midlands
Location: Infirmary Square
LE1 5WW Leicester
United Kingdom
1. Are these conditions managed within this unit or do they refer to another unit? (see options below)
In own unit
Refer to another unit
Not used
1a. Specialist MDT assessment for TED patients: In own unit
1b. High dose intravenous steroids: In own unit
1c. Second line immunosuppression drugs: In own unit
1d. Decompression surgery for TED patients: In own unit
1e. Lid/oculoplastic surgery for TED patients: In own unit
1f. Strabismus surgery for TED patients: In own unit
1g. Orbital radiotherapy: In own unit
1h. Is written information given to patients? Yes, Our own leaflet
2. Location of the endocrine service: On Site
3. Do TED patients see the endocrinologist and ophthalmologist at the same appointment? Yes
Frequency: Twice a month
4a. Services offered within your trust: Smoking cessation, Immunosuppression specialist, Radio-iodine treatment, Thyroidectomy
